游戏建模(Game Modeling)是游戏开发中的一个关键环节,指的是创建游戏中的虚拟世界、角色、物体、场景、动画等的数字化表示。游戏建模是游戏开发流程中非常重要的一环,它直接影响游戏的视觉效果、性能和用户体验。
游戏建模的主要内容和类型:
1. 3D建模(3D Modeling)
- 作用:创建游戏中的三维物体、场景、角色等。
- 工具:Maya、Blender、3ds Max、ZBrush、Substance Painter 等。
- 类型:
- 静态模型:如建筑物、道具、武器等。
- 动态模型:如角色、车辆、飞行器等。
- 地形模型:如山地、水域、城市等。
2. 角色建模(Character Modeling)
- 作用:创建游戏中的角色,包括人物、怪物、NPC(非玩家角色)等。
- 特点:需要考虑骨骼结构、表情、动作、材质等。
- 工具:Blender、Maya、ZBrush 等。
3. 场景建模(Scene Modeling)
- 作用:创建游戏中的环境,如城市、森林、洞穴、太空等。
- 特点:需要考虑光照、材质、纹理、地形等。
- 工具:Blender、Maya、3ds Max 等。
4. 动画建模(Animation Modeling)
- 作用:为模型赋予动作、表情、运动轨迹等。
- 类型:
- 骨骼动画:角色的骨骼运动。
- 关键帧动画:人物的动作、表情、物体的运动。
- 模拟动画:如风、水、火焰等自然现象的模拟。
5. 材质与纹理建模(Material and Texture Modeling)
- 作用:为模型赋予材质、颜色、光泽、反射等属性。
- 工具:Substance Painter、Blender、Photoshop、Unity/Unreal Engine 等。
- 特点:需要考虑光照效果、材质的物理属性等。
6. 游戏引擎集成建模
- 作用:将建模结果导入游戏引擎(如Unity、Unreal Engine)进行渲染、动画、物理模拟等。
- 工具:Unity、Unreal Engine、Godot 等。
游戏建模的流程:
- 概念设计:确定游戏的主题、世界观、角色设定等。
- 建模:使用建模工具创建模型。
- 材质与纹理:为模型添加材质、纹理。
- 动画:为模型添加动作、表情、运动。
- 场景设计:创建场景、环境、光照。
- 渲染与优化:将模型导入游戏引擎,进行渲染、优化。
- 测试与调整:测试模型在游戏中的表现,进行调整。
游戏建模的重要性:
- 视觉效果:决定游戏的视觉风格和沉浸感。
- 性能:影响游戏的运行流畅度和资源消耗。
- 玩法体验:影响玩家对游戏的沉浸感和操作体验。
- 开发效率:建模是游戏开发的重要环节,直接影响开发进度和成本。
总结:
游戏建模是游戏开发中不可或缺的一部分,涉及建模、动画、材质、场景等多个方面。它不仅影响游戏的视觉表现,还影响游戏的性能和用户体验。优秀的游戏建模能够提升游戏的吸引力和市场竞争力。
如果你有具体的游戏类型或开发方向,我可以进一步帮你分析建模的具体需求和流程。